I,with my friends plan to make 3D animated short films based on classic fairytales and sell them to some TV channel. We plan to write our own script based on the fairy tales and folk tales taken from the internet and from libraries. some of these stories have unknown authors and some have been compiled by someone. So, if I use these sources for my works, will there be a violation of copy rights, intellectual property rights and stuff like that?
